About Brett Smith Sylvester at a glance

Brett Smith Sylvester is a Member based in Washington, District of Columbia, practicing at Sughrue Mion, PLLC. They have 39+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1987. Their practice focuses on real estate, ip, litigation, and internet. Admitted to practice in Illinois (1987) and District of Columbia registered to practice before U.S. Patent and Trademark Office (1989). Educated at John Marshall Law School (J.D., 1987) and Cornell University (B.S., 1984). Active member of The District of Columbia Bar American Bar Association (Member, Section of Patent, Trademark and Copyright Law) American Intellectual Property Law Association. Serands clients in Washington, DC and the surrounding metropolitan area.
